Abstract

While most researches study sampled-data systems from the discrete-time system viewpoint, their actual responses are continuous-time functions so that their performance must be evaluated not only at sampled instants but also during intersample periods. This paper studies a method of ripple-free deadbeat control design for sampled-data systems taking into account the continuous-time transient response. The indicial response is obtained so as to minimize the mean square error performance index.
